#1172ef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1172ef is composed of 6.7% red, 44.7%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.9% cyan, 52.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 213.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 50.2%. #1172ef color hex could be obtained by blending #22e4ff with #0000df.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

#1172ef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1172ef has RGB values of R:17, G:114,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 1143535.
